Italian Basil Chicken Cutlets
Italian Basil Chicken Cutlets with Tomato and Burrata Topping
A vibrant, Italian-inspired main dish featuring crispy chicken, juicy blistered tomatoes, fresh basil, creamy burrata, and a sweet-tangy balsamic drizzle.

Ingredients
For the Chicken Cutlets
- 4 boneless, skinless chicken breasts (pounded thin)
- ½ cup all-purpose flour
- 3 large eggs, whisked
- 1½ cups Italian-style panko breadcrumbs
- Salt & freshly ground black pepper
- Neutral oil (vegetable or canola) for shallow frying
For the Tomato Basil Topping
- 2 cups cherry tomatoes
- 1½ cups fresh basil, chiffonade (thinly sliced)
- 2 tbsp extra virgin olive oil
- 3 garlic cloves, minced
- ½ tsp kosher salt
- ¼ cup dry white wine
- 1 tsp lemon juice
- 1 tsp lemon zest
For Serving
- 1 ball of burrata, torn into pieces
- 2 tbsp balsamic glaze
Instructions
1. Prep the Chicken
- Place chicken breasts between plastic wrap and pound to even thickness.
- Season both sides with salt and pepper.
2. Bread the Chicken
- Set up a breading station:
- Bowl 1: Flour
- Bowl 2: Beaten eggs
- Bowl 3: Panko breadcrumbs
- Dredge each cutlet in flour (shake off excess), dip in egg, and coat thoroughly in breadcrumbs.
3. Fry the Cutlets
- Heat about ½ inch of oil in a large skillet over medium heat (325°F).
- Fry each cutlet for 2–3 minutes per side, or until golden brown and cooked through.
- Transfer to a paper towel-lined plate to drain.
4. Make the Tomato Basil Topping
- In the same skillet, heat olive oil over medium.
- Add cherry tomatoes and cook for 5 minutes until blistered and softened.
- Stir in garlic and salt; cook for 1 minute more.
- Deglaze with white wine, scraping any browned bits. Simmer for 1–2 minutes.
- Transfer mixture to a bowl and stir in basil, lemon juice, and zest.
5. Assemble & Serve
- Arrange cutlets on a serving platter.
- Spoon tomato-basil topping over the chicken.
- Add torn burrata and drizzle with balsamic glaze.

Tips for Success

- Even Thickness = Even Cooking: Pound cutlets evenly for best texture.
- Fresh Is Best: Use high-quality burrata and fresh basil for standout flavor.
- Don’t Skip Deglazing: It adds incredible depth to the tomato topping.
Make-Ahead & Substitutions
- Make Ahead: Bread cutlets and prep tomato topping up to 24 hours ahead.
- No Burrata? Use mozzarella or ricotta instead.
- Baking Option: Bake breaded cutlets at 400°F for 20–25 minutes instead of frying.
